Default LS460 Recommendation

Hey everyone, first post here. Sorry if I ask same questions again. I read lots of threads but always find contrasting info.

I am looking to purchase 2014 ls460 awd with 161k miles. About 12-13k$ in USA.

Carfax is clean, looks like all maintenance has been done on time and fuel pump replaced after a little over 100k.

Only thing which I don't see in Carfax or Lexus service history is transmission fluid change. Do I need to worry too much about it ? Should I flush after getting it or Lexus dealership offers Drain & fill ?
Second, its got two minor accidents, from carfax looks like cosmetic stuff and no airbags deployed.

What are your opinions. Should I pull the trigger or wait for something better ? Car looks clean.
